排序
告别静态分析的噩梦:WordPress Stubs 助力代码质量提升
我最近在开发一个wordpress插件,使用了psalm进行静态分析。由于插件依赖于wordpress核心代码,psalm在分析过程中总是报错,提示找不到各种wordpress函数和类。这导致我的代码审查过程非常低效...
thinkphp用什么编辑器
thinkphp可用的编辑器有:1、PHPStorm;2、Visual Studio Code;3、Eclipse;4、Zend Studio;5、Sublime Text;6、PHP Designer;7、NetBeans等。 本教程操作环境:Windows7系统、thinkphp v5....
在 Mac 上进行 Go 交叉编译时,是否需要每次都手动切换 GOOS 环境变量?
Mac 上 Go 语言交叉编译:告别手动切换 GOOS 环境变量 在 macOS 上进行 Go 语言开发时,经常需要交叉编译,例如为 Linux 系统生成可执行文件。 频繁手动设置 GOOS 环境变量不仅繁琐,还容易出错...
最新版PhpStudy安装教程:全系统适用指南
phpstudy最新版安装教程适用于windows、linux和macos。1.下载安装包:从官方网站或镜像站点下载phpstudy的安装包。2.解压和配置:自动解压安装包,并根据系统类型进行相应的配置。3.启动服务:...
Android Gradle插件需要Java 11,为何我的项目仍然报错?
Android项目编译错误:Gradle插件与JDK版本冲突 Android开发中,编译错误时有发生。本文针对“Android Gradle plugin requires Java 11”错误提供解决方案。 问题描述: 编译Android项目时,出...
全面Java面试题及答案整合
java面试常见问题包括内存模型、垃圾回收、多线程、集合框架等。1. java内存模型分为堆、栈、方法区。2. 垃圾回收机制自动管理内存。3. 多线程通过thread类或runnable接口创建,synchronized用...
如何使用lambda表达式?
lambda表达式是一种简洁的匿名函数,适用于需要短小精悍的函数定义场景。1) 它简化代码,使其更简洁易读;2) 支持函数式编程,实现高阶函数和闭包;3) 提供灵活性,适合一次性或短期使用的函数...
WebStorm运行Node.js脚本的配置和操作
在webstorm中运行node.js脚本需要创建运行配置。1)确保已安装node.js环境。2)在webstorm中创建并管理运行配置,定义脚本路径和参数。3)点击运行按钮启动脚本,并使用调试工具优化性能。 引言 在...
VirtualBox在Ubuntu中如何增加硬盘容量
要在virtualbox中为ubuntu虚拟机增加硬盘容量,您可以按照以下步骤操作: 关闭虚拟机:首先,确保您的Ubuntu虚拟机已经关闭。 打开VirtualBox管理器:在您的主机操作系统上打开VirtualBox管理器...
Notepad++运行CSS代码查看样式效果的操作
在notepad++中查看css效果需要借助外部工具。1) 保存css文件并创建一个html文件引入css。2) 用浏览器打开html文件查看效果。3) 安装nppexec插件并使用命令启动浏览器预览。 要在Notepad++中运行...
WebStorm运行HTML页面的多种方式
在webstorm中,可以通过三种方式运行html页面:1. 直接从编辑器中运行,点击右键选择“open in browser”;2. 使用内置的live edit功能,实时查看代码修改效果;3. 通过自定义服务器运行,如配...